APAR Anushakti HR FR LSH

E-beam house wire — heat-resistant to 105°C, low smoke, zero halogen.
APAR Anushakti HR FR LSH is a premium single-core house wire engineered with Electron Beam (E-beam) technology. The cross-linking gives it up to 50% higher current-carrying capacity, heat resistance to 105°C, and halogen-free, low-smoke insulation that resists flame and melting — making it one of the safest house wires for modern homes and commercial buildings.

Dimensions & ratings

Technical data
Conductor & current rating
Size (sq mm)ConstructionInsulation (mm)O.D. (mm)Resistance (Ω/km)In conduit (A)Clipped (A)
0.75 / Class 524/0.20.62.20261116
1 / Class 27/0.430.72.7018.11624
1 / Class 532/0.20.62.4019.51624
1.5 / Class 27/0.530.73.0012.12032
1.5 / Class 530/0.250.72.8513.302032
2.5 / Class 27/0.670.83.607.412744
2.5 / Class 550/0.250.83.507.982744
4 / Class 27/0.850.84.104.613658
4 / Class 556/0.30.84.04.953658
6 / Class 27/1.040.84.703.084774
6 / Class 584/0.30.84.503.304774

FAQs

Good to know

What does HR FR LSH mean?+

HR FR LSH stands for Heat-Resistant, Flame-Retardant, Low Smoke and Halogen. It resists flame spread, emits very low smoke and no toxic halogen gases in a fire, and withstands high operating temperatures without insulation failure.

How is it different from ordinary house wire?+

It is made with Electron Beam (E-beam) technology, which cross-links the insulation for up to 50% more current-carrying capacity, heat resistance to 105°C, and melt/short-circuit resistance — well beyond conventional PVC wires.

Where is it best used?+

Ideal for residential and commercial buildings, distribution boards, appliance and control-panel wiring, and fire-sensitive environments such as hospitals and institutions.

What is the service life?+

Its E-beam cross-linked insulation gives a service life of over 50 years under normal operating conditions.
